NAME

Bio::Search::Hit::Fasta - Hit object specific for Fasta-generated hits

SYNOPSIS

   # You wouldn't normally create these manually; 
   # instead they would be produced by Bio::SearchIO::fasta
 
   use Bio::Search::Hit::Fasta;
   my $hit = Bio::Search::Hit::Fasta->new(id=>'LBL_6321', desc=>'lipoprotein', e_val=>0.01);
 
 

DESCRIPTION

Bio::Search::Hit::HitI objects are data structures that contain information about specific hits obtained during a library search. Some information will be algorithm-specific, but others will be generally defined, such as the ability to obtain alignment objects corresponding to each hit.
